We're buried in snow here in the Midwest, and me and my wife were shovelling the driveway so I could move my car.

Simple enough.

After a couple hours, we decided to call it a day. It was dark by that time, and as we were heading in my wife discovered she had lost her wedding ring! Needless to say, she was very, very upset. She was in tears and nearly frantic, so I immediately ran inside to get my 8 year old daughter. "Get dressed, and grab the flashlights!"

We all headed back outside, decked out in our cold weather gear and packing photons. I was armed with my SureFire L4 (KL4/E2e), my daughter had a SL TT-2L, and my wife an Inova T1.

We searched and searched, and after a few minutes my wife was ready to give up. Not 10 seconds later, I found the ring! It was buried under the snow, but the L4 brought the gold to life.

My wife was overjoyed, and for the first time ever I heard these words: "I'll never say another word about you and your flashlights!"

Heh. I have to say, it was a good day.
